LAPD shoots armed robbery suspect after there was a struggle with victim

Two people are recovering from gunshot wounds after standing up to an armed robber on Saturday night in South Los Angeles, according to police.
According to the Los Angeles Police Department’s preliminary investigation, it was around 11:30 p.m. when the suspected robber walked up to two victims standing on a sidewalk in front of a church on the 1700 block of East 114th Street.
The suspect, who LAPD later identified as 54-year-old Kevin Doby, allegedly used an AK-style rifle to demand the victims’ property. Officials did not immediately identify the victims.
As Doby was attempting to rob the two people at gunpoint, LAPD said the victims charged at him and took Doby to the ground.
“As the victims and suspect struggled over control of the gun, Southeast Patrol Division uniformed officers were conducting a regular patrol in the area and observed the group fighting,” LAPD said in a release.
As the officers got out of their car and approached the fight, one of the victims yelled, “He’s got a gun!” multiple times, according to the report.
The officers called for backup and began giving numerous verbal orders to Doby, telling him to drop the gun, as he was still struggling with the victims.
LAPD said as the victims attempted to break away from Doby, at least one officer opened fire.
Doby then “rearmed himself with the rifle and began to run” when officers again opened fire.
“During the incident, the suspect was struck by the gunfire and dropped the rifle under a nearby parked car.”
The responding officers redeployed as backup units arrived and took Doby into custody without further incident.
Doby was hit with gunfire and was transported to a hospital in stable condition before he was placed under arrest for armed robbery, according to LAPD.
LAPD said it was later determined that the victims were also struck by gunfire during the shooting, and were taken to a different hospital, where they were also listed in stable condition.
Investigators found a loaded black and brown AK-style, .22 caliber rifle, and an approximately 3-inch folding knife and collected them as evidence.
LAPD said no officers or other community members were injured during this incident.
